How to Reach Gangtok
Reach Gangtok by Flight, Train, Road
So, how do you actually reach Gangtok? Don’t worry you’ve got a few good and simple options!
By Flight
Book a flight to Bagdogra Airport (IXB) – this is the nearest airport to Gangtok (about 125 km away).Bagdogra is well connected with direct flights from Delhi, Mumbai, Kolkata, Hyderabad, Bangalore, and Chennai. fter landing at Bagdogra you can take shared taxi or private taxi or you can coming to tenzing norgay bus stand from there you can take bus, taxi. Helicopter services from Bagdogra to Gangtok are sometimes available but depend on the weather and schedules.
By Train
There’s no direct train to Gangtok, but the nearest big railway station is New Jalpaiguri (NJP). It’s an important stop for trains which coming from all over India. From NJP, you can hire a cab or take a shared jeep to Gangtok.
By Road
If you’re already near Siliguri, Bagdogra, or NJP, you can also drive to Gangtok or take a bus or shared jeep. The roads are pretty good, and the mountain drive is enjoyable!
Siliguri to Gangtok Bus Timetable
Operator | Departure Time | Fare (₹) | Bus Type | Boarding Point (Siliguri) | Dropping Point (Gangtok) | Duration |
SNT (Sikkim Nationalised) | 06:00 AM – 03:00 PM | 288 (approx) | Non-AC Seater & Ac | SNT Bus Stand, Hill Cart Rd | SNT Bus Stand, Deorali | ~5 hours |
APSARA Bus Service | 06:40 AM | 235 | Non-AC, 2+2 Seater | SNT Bus Stand, Siliguri | Ranipool (near Gangtok) | ~5 hours |
NBSTC | 05:30 AM, 12:30 PM | Varies | Govt. Bus | NBSTC Stand, Siliguri | Gangtok | ~5 hours |

Reach Gangtok from Different Cities
How to Reach Gangtok from Delhi
The fastest way is to fly from Delhi to Bagdogra Airport, which takes around 2.5 hours. From Bagdogra, Gangtok is about 125 km, and it takes 4 to 5 hours by road. You can hire a private taxi, shared cab, or go to Tenzing Norgay Bus Stand in Siliguri (around 15 km from Bagdogra) to catch a Sikkim Nationalised Transport (SNT) bus to Gangtok.
Train option: Delhi to New Jalpaiguri (NJP) takes 24–30 hours, then follow the same road journey.
How to Reach Gangtok from Mumbai
Take a flight from Mumbai to Bagdogra – usually around 3 hours (non-stop or with one layover). Then travel 125 km by road to Gangtok.
By train, Mumbai to NJP takes 34–38 hours. After reaching NJP, go by taxi, shared jeep, or take a bus from Tenzing Norgay Bus Stand to Gangtok.
How to Reach Gangtok from Kolkata
Kolkata to Bagdogra flights take 1 hour, making it the fastest route. After that, cover the remaining 125 km to Gangtok by road (4–5 hours).
Train option: Kolkata to NJP takes 10–12 hours, and then take a taxi or take SNT bus from Tenzing Norgay Bus Stand in Siliguri.
By road, it’s a 675 km journey which around 16–18 hours by car or bus.
How to Reach Gangtok from Hyderabad
Fly from Hyderabad to Bagdogra (via Delhi/Kolkata) – flight time is about 3.5 to 4.5 hours. Then, take a taxi or shared jeep to Gangtok.
By train, it takes around 30–34 hours to NJP. From there, continue your journey via taxi or get an SNT bus from Tenzing Norgay Bus Stand.
How to Reach Gangtok from Patna
Patna to New Jalpaiguri (NJP) by train takes around 8 to 10 hours (about 490 km). After reaching NJP, you can take a taxi, shared cab, or hop on a bus from Tenzing Norgay Bus Stand to Gangtok.
Flights from Patna to Bagdogra are available (usually via Kolkata) and take around 3–4 hours including layovers.
How to Reach Gangtok from Bangalore
Fly from Bangalore to Bagdogra (3.5 to 4 hours, often with one stop). Then drive or take a cab to Gangtok – 125 km in 4–5 hours.
Train from Bangalore to NJP takes around 40 hours, so flying is the better option. After reaching NJP, follow the road journey or use SNT bus service from Tenzing Norgay Bus Stand.
How to Reach Gangtok from Chennai
Take a flight from Chennai to Bagdogra (usually with one stop) – travel time is around 4 hours. Then, travel the last 125 km to Gangtok by road.
By train, Chennai to NJP takes 36–40 hours. From NJP, take a taxi or a bus from Tenzing Norgay Bus Stand to Gangtok.
Travel Tips for Reaching Gangtok
- Book flights early: Flights to Bagdogra can get full during peak season (spring and autumn), so book in advance to get good prices and seats.
- Plan your road trip: The road from Bagdogra or NJP to Gangtok is winding and hilly. Make sure to carry light luggage and be ready for some mountain driving.
- Use reliable transport: Choose trusted taxis or official shared cabs. If you’re taking the bus from Tenzing Norgay Bus Stand, check the schedule a day before.
- Carry snacks and water: The drive takes around 4-5 hours, and stops are limited, so pack some snacks and water for the journey.
- Prepare for weather changes: Gangtok’s weather can change quickly, especially if you’re traveling in winter or monsoon. Carry warm clothes and rain gear just in case.
- Keep local currency handy: Small towns en route may have limited digital payment options, so carry some cash for tolls and refreshments.

Can we reach Gangtok by train?

There is no direct rail route to reach Gangtok by train, however, you can travel to New Jalpaiguri Railway Station (NJP), and from there you can book a private taxi or shareable taxi and travel to Gangtok. In the upcoming time, you can also travel to Rangpo using the Sivok-Rangpo channel, which is expected to be in operation from December 2024.

Which month is ice in Gangtok?

You can find ice in Gangtok during the winter season, which is between the end of December and mid-February.
How much does the Gangtok trip cost?

In general, a 3 to 4-day Gangtok trip would cost around ₹7500 to ₹17500 per person or more which may change based on your accommodation, food, and activities that you intend to participate in during your stay in Gangtok.
